What's it like Living in Lyons?

Located in the state of Georgia, Lyons is a small-sized city with a population of 4,392 inhabitants. Lyons is known to be an ethnically diverse city. The two most common races are White (56%) and Black or African American (32%). If you are not a fan of long commutes, you will enjoy living in Lyons. With an average one way commute time of only 18 minutes, getting to and from work is a breeze compared to the national average of 26 minutes.

To help you find the best places to live in and around Lyons, AreaVibes has created a livability score using key metrics like amenities, crime, employment and more.

The livability score in Lyons is 61/100 and the city is ranked in the 41st percentile of all cities across America. If we check out each of the categories on their own, we see that Lyons ranks well for housing (A). Lyons does not fare well for the following: amenities (F), education (F) and employment (F). Assuming that Lyons meets all of your requirements like low crime rates, good schools and great local amenities, the next most important item to examine is the affordability of real estate in Lyons. Everything else becomes a lot less important if it turns out that home prices in Lyons are simply unattainable. The median home price for Lyons homes is $130,600, which is 53% lower than the Georgia average. If we take a closer look at the affordability of homes in Lyons, we’ll see that the home price to income ratio is 3.4, which is 8.1% lower than the Georgia average.

      Lyons transportation information

      Statistic Lyons Georgia National
      Average one way commute18min28min26min
      Workers who drive to work78.2%79.6%76.4%
      Workers who carpool10.8%10.1%9.3%
      Workers who take public transit0.0%2.1%5.1%
      Workers who bicycle0.0%0.2%0.6%
      Workers who walk9.4%1.6%2.8%
      Working from home1.7%5.1%4.6%
      Source: The Lyons, GA data and statistics displayed above are derived from the United States Census Bureau American Community Survey (ACS) and include 2026 modeled data developed using proprietary methodologies.
